AuthorsLive: The Perfect Story: How to Tell Stories That Inform, Influence, and Inspire by Karen Eber

AuthorsLive welcomes Karen Eber, CEO, Chief Storyteller, and author of The Perfect Story: How to Tell Stories That Inform, Influence, and Inspire for a two-hour, interactive storytelling talk with hands-on activities introducing the steps for finding and telling the perfect story for each occasion.

The need for clear and meaningful communication has never been more critical in our information-saturated world. Those who can effectively inform, influence, and inspire their audience gain a significant advantage. Even as AI advances, storytelling remains a key human skill for building trust and forming connections.

However, it’s not enough to tell a story. The way you tell one impacts the experience and outcome—determined by how well it engages the audience’s brain.

In The Perfect Story, Karen Eber demonstrates how to scientifically hack the art of storytelling by leveraging the Five Factory Settings of the Brain. She makes storytelling accessible by sharing where to find story ideas, and how to apply a simple, memorable model for telling stories that inform, influence, and inspire for any setting.

This talk covers:

  • Describing and applying the science of storytelling.
  • Finding endless ideas for stories to tell.
  • Defining your audience and the desired outcomes for the story.
  • Applying a structure to the story.
  • Including details and emotions that engage the brain.

Whether you’re leading a team, giving a presentation, selling a product or service, interviewing for a job or communicating data, learn how to find and tell the perfect story for each audience.

Karen Eber is an international consultant, author, and keynote speaker that has educated and motivated over three million people globally. Her talk on TED.com: How your brain responds to stories – and why they’re crucial for leaders, continues to inspire millions. Her book, The Perfect Story: How to Tell Stories that Inform, Influence, and Inspire (HarperCollins) was selected as a Next Big Idea Club must-read and is a Porchlight Books bestseller. Click here to learn more about Karen's 20+ years of experience, during which she has been a Head of Culture and Chief Learning Officer at General Electric and a Head of Leadership Development at Deloitte. Karen holds a Master’s in Instructional Design and a Bachelor’s in Psychology and resides in Atlanta, GA.
